 Two months ago, Justin Frankel created an ingenious little software
tool that allows its users to bypass the dominant Internet companies and
communicate directly among themselves. His bosses at America Online
Inc., the biggest computing network of them all, were so impressed they
tried to snuff it out of existence.
 Within 24 hours, AOL officials had removed the tool, called Gnutella,
from the Web site of its Nullsoft development house. It was, they
declared, an "unauthorized freelance project."
 But they were too late. About 10,000 people had already
downloaded the program onto their own machines, creating bustling
networks for the free exchange of everything from digital music files and
pictures to political propaganda beyond the control of AOL, its merger
partner Time Warner Inc. or anyone else.
 Both the beauty and danger of Gnutella are that it is a more
sophisticated version of Napster, the infamous and popular program that
college students have been using to swap music files over the Web.
Napster's developers have recently been hit with a flurry of copyright-
infringement lawsuits. But unlike users of Napster, Gnutella aficionados
can trade files without going through a storage center, making it
impossible to shut down the system without unplugging every computer
on the network and difficult to control by laws because there's no central
authority.
 Marc Andreessen, a co-founder of Netscape Communications and a
former chief technology officer for AOL, compares Gnutella to a
benevolent virus, a "revolutionary" program that spreads the power of
publishing from an elite set of corporations to anyone who has a
computer.
 "It changes the Internet in a way that it hasn't changed since the
browser," Andreessen said.
 At a time when the general assumption is that the World Wide Web's
destiny will be guided by international conglomerates such as AOL,
Amazon.com Inc., Yahoo Inc. and Microsoft Corp., Gnutella is the
unexpected variable.
 Its very existence is a statement about the wild nature of the Web
and how difficult it will be for anyone to tame it. It is also a dramatic
display of how easily the Internet can be transformed or at least shaken
by smart computer programmers who are barely old enough to drink or
drive.
 Frankel, 21, and his good friend and software co-creator, Tom
Pepper, another twentysomething Nullsoft employee, have become
virtual cult heroes. Their work is being refined daily by hundreds of
young volunteer programmers around the world who hope to extend
Gnutella's reach, making it a free search engine for the masses.
 The decentralization of power that Gnutella represents has revived
the romantic dream of many a cyberspace pioneer--that of a truly free
realm where no information gatekeeper exists and where all property is
commonly owned. But those who hope to profit handsomely from the
Internet's transformation into a global marketplace--record companies,
book publishers, movie makers and practically everyone else with a
stake in selling information--regard Gnutella as a device for thievery.
 It was, after all, Gerald Levin, chief executive of Time Warner Inc.,
which owns the Warner Music label, who called on his AOL counterpart,
Steve Case, to quash the Gnutella project.
 Carey Heckman, a professor of law and technology at Stanford
University, said the software could undermine the foundation of many
multibillion-dollar corporations.
 "It's about how information flows and who controls that system,"
Heckman said. "The idea of a handful of institutions filtering information
may be decaying."

Origin of a New Species

 The name Gnutella comes from a combination of Gnu, the popular
suite of free Unix software, and Nutella, the chocolatey hazelnut spread
that Frankel is said to favor. It is the most advanced of a new generation
of what are known as "distributed network" programs with names like
Freenet and iMesh.
 Freenet, also a relative of Napster, is the brainchild of Ian
Clarke, a
23-year-old in London. The program, which is still in the early stages of
development, has drawn attention because it deliberately makes it all but
impossible to identify the source of a file. Thus it could act as a
megaphone for political dissidents fearful of retribution, as well as
potentially a gathering place for terrorists, pornographers and other
malevolent users. "People should be free to distribute information
without restrictions of any form," Clarke said in an e-mail.

Digital Society


Virus Ambulance Chasers


Hidden network virus eats TV newscaster brains.

The hype surrounding the "NewLove" virus is spreading, well, like a virus --
and at the center of the hype are the companies themselves.

"Anti-virus companies have always been seen as ambulance chasers, and
sometimes, it's true," said Dan Schrader, the chief security analyst at Trend
Micro. "Because this is an industry that has been built on hype and alerts
and pretensions of being good citizens, the industry doesn't have a lot of
credibility."

That's what happened Friday, Schrader said, when numerous alerts were sent
out by anti-virus companies, and the virus only affected a small number of
computers and networks. But the media, and even Janet Reno, did their part to
fuel the fire as well.

"I have to admit this whole thing became a media feeding frenzy," said
Schrader, who estimated he had been interviewed a dozen times since 5 a.m.
(PDT) Friday morning.

"This whole industry runs on hysteria," said Rob Rosenberger, webmaster of
Computer Virus Myths. "It's just one more press release about a virus that's
probably going nowhere."

News of the virus spread rapidly as soon as it was discovered. Trend Micro
learned that one of its customers was infected with the newer, nasty virus
late Thursday, Schrader said. A reporter called him, having heard from
anti-virus company Symantec that one of its customers was also affected, and
Trend Micro then decided to call the Associated Press.

"This thing is all of a sudden snowballing," Schrader said.

Ironically, the "NewLove" virus, while nasty, has had nowhere near the effect
that its pesky cousin "Love Bug" did two weeks ago.

"We really haven't seen it out there that much," admitted McAfee director Sal
Viveros.
But Schrader said that despite the hype, there are legitimate reasons to
inform the media to get the word out quickly.

"We need to educate 300 million people overnight, and that is an absurd
responsibility," Schrader said. "The pressure to (tell the media) is huge
because you never know when one of these viruses will be the big one."

"The proactive notification of customers is a responsible thing to do," said
Tom Powledge, a group product manager for Symantec.

McAfee's Viveros added that any time there is a huge outbreak like the Love
Bug, companies are also on high alert.

"Historically, we see a whole slew of copycats and variants after a major
virus outbreak," Viveros said. "We're monitoring extra closely."

Over-hyping of computer viruses is not a new phenomenon. The most notorious
example of hype was during the Michelangelo virus in 1992. John McAfee,
founder of McAfee Associates, warned that Michelangelo would hit 20 million
computers, when in fact the virus infected 20,000 computers at best, Schrader
said.

And he believes there are better ways of preventing virus outbreaks, and the
media circus that surrounds them.

"If we had 200 of the largest ISPs scanning the traffic they're delivering
for viruses, we wouldn't have an outbreak of (the "Love Bug") magnitude,"
Schrader said.

He pointed out that US West already does this for its customers, and British
Telecom also has plans to scan for viruses.

Rosenberger of the Computer Virus Myths homepage said that the problem will
be corrected once users demand anti-virus software that can detect viruses
before they infect computers, instead of the after-the-fact detection that
companies use now.

"Users are the biggest avenue to change," Rosenberger said.

Nevertheless, part of the credit that the virus was so easily contained was
that people are becoming more aware of these invaders.

"The virus companies were ready and the users were ready," said Chris Vargas,
president of F-Secure. "People were ready for this, which is really good
news."

AIDS Virus Could Fight Disease

May 5, 2000 — Stripped of its harmful components, the AIDS virus could become
a vital weapon in the fight against genetic diseases, cancer and even AIDS
itself, a research team announced Thursday.
The team from the Pasteur Institute in Paris said it can show that the AIDS
virus is capable of introducing genes into an organism to replace faulty
genes which can provoke genetic diseases. The virus could also be used as a
"transporter" to deliver a vaccine to suppress cancerous tumors, or in the
case of AIDS to introduce blocking genes to stop the spread of the virus.

"All the genes in the (AIDS) virus would be replaced by 'healing-genes', and
we would only keep from the actual virus the machinery which allows it to
penetrate into cells," according to study leader Pierre Charneau.

The transporter virus is to be tested soon on monkeys infected with the SIV
virus, closely related to HIV. Researchers will use it to try to stop the
illness which normally kills the animal within six months.

Agence France-Presse, Copyright 2000

Britain's sending of over a thousand crack troops to Sierra Leone is a major
turn to direct intervention in Africa that has serious repercussions for both
the African masses and workers in the West.

As with previous military actions by the Blair Labour government in the Middle
East and the Balkans, the Sierra Leone operation was never discussed in
parliament until after the fact. Nor was there any attempt in advance of the
troop deployment to inform the British people. The undemocratic manner in which
the operation was launched is consistent with its character as a colonial-style
adventure. Its aims are two-fold: to secure immediate British interests in
Sierra Leone, and to demonstrate to London's great power rivals that Britain is
a major player in Africa, with the military muscle to back up its economic and
political ambitions.

To all intents and purposes, Britain has assumed de facto control of the
government of its former colony. It effectively mounted a take-over of the
United Nations mission, the Sierra Leone army and the pro-government militias
by the simple expedient of sending a small number of British "advisors" and SAS
men to take charge, and following this up with a substantial armed force.

Sierra Leone is the largest independent military operation carried out by
Britain since Margaret Thatcher dispatched a British task force to the Malvinas
(Falklands Islands) in 1982. Its forces are made up of 800 members of the
Parachute Regiment, 40 Special Air Service operatives and a further 600 Royal
Marines stationed offshore in combat readiness. The aircraft carrier HMS
Illustrious, the helicopter assault ship Oregon, three support ships and a
frigate are stationed in the capital Freetown's harbour.

The Labour government of Prime Minister Tony Blair has repeatedly redefined the
mission since it initially promised the action would be limited to “non-
combatant evacuation” of British nationals. It is now described by the
government as an exercise in “military diplomacy”.

Government spokesman at first insisted that British troops would not be
involved in direct confrontations with the rebel forces of Foday Sankoh's
Revolutionay United Front (RUF), but the Paras have already killed four RUF
members, while Brigadier David Richards let it be known that he would interpret
his “mission statement” liberally.

Notwithstanding its humanitarian rhetoric, the British government has spent
next to nothing combating the desperate poverty in Sierra Leone or providing
financial assistance to revive the economy. Almost all British aid has gone to
training the army and police. The issue of who controls Sierra Leone's mineral
wealth and, by extension, the far greater resources throughout Africa is the
Blair government's central concern.

Sierra Leone, officially the least developed country in the world, is wracked
by a civil war being fought over control of the country's diamond deposits.
According to the US State Department, Liberia presently exports £200 million
worth of diamonds a year, almost all of which come from Sierra Leone and are
supplied by the RUF rebels.

Ahmed Tejan Kabbah's Sierra Leone People's Party was elected in February 1996,
having promised to stabilise the country and make its safe for international
investors. But in May 1997, Major General Johnny Paul Koroma, an ally of the
RUF, carried through a military coup. The West African countries sent in a
“peacekeeping” force dominated by Nigeria, and the UN ordered a halt to the
supply of arms and petroleum products to Sierra Leone.

Unhappy with restrictions on its ability to intervene directly in Sierra Leone,
the Foreign Office in London came to an arrangement with the mercenary outfit
Sandline International for the purpose of breaching the UN embargo and aiding
pro-government forces. Sandline's specific remit was to help regain control of
the diamond producing areas.

Kabbah was returned to power on March 10, 1998, but in May the Blair government
was enmeshed in scandal after the agreement with Sandline came to public
attention. With the RUF continuing its attacks, Sandline forced to withdraw,
and the West African intervention force in disarray, the initiative in Sierra
Leone passed to the US—with Jesse Jackson playing a key role in securing a July
1999 peace agreement with the RUF.

The rebel forces received government posts and an amnesty for war crimes, with
Sankoh named Minister of Mines. But fighting continued between the RUF and UN
troops, as did abductions, rapes and other atrocities. Sankoh was not prepared
to relinquish his control of the diamond trade, and when this was threatened
earlier this spring his forces took some 500 UN troops hostage.

The New York Times

May 18, 2000

Editorial

The Last Battle of the Gulf War
The Army this week brushed off new reports that American forces needlessly
attacked retreating Iraqi troops after a cease-fire was declared in the
Persian Gulf war. The accounts, contained in a New Yorker article written by
Seymour Hersh, cannot be so easily dismissed. Though questions about the
battle were raised as the war ended in 1991, and subsequent Army
investigations found no fault, there is good reason for the Pentagon and
Congress to revisit the matter. Some officers familiar with the American
assault offer detailed testimony that one of the country's most decorated
commanders, Gen. Barry McCaffrey, ordered a punishing and unwarranted attack.

The sequence of events described by Mr. Hersh is complex and filled with the
confusion and ambiguities that are common in war. There are conflicting
accounts about what happened and why, and General McCaffrey, now retired from
the Army and serving as the Clinton administration's top drug-control
official, has vigorously defended his actions. But none of that justifies the
Army's cavalier response to the New Yorker article. Few matters are more
important to a democracy than the conduct of its military forces, and any
credible accusation of reckless or unjustified killing by American servicemen
must be thoroughly investigated by an independent panel of experts. The
Army's internal inquiries are not an adequate answer.

The core issue raised by the Hersh piece is whether General McCaffrey, who
was commander of the 24th Infantry Division, deliberately provoked a fight
with retreating Iraqi forces after the cease-fire was in place by blocking a
main escape route and then seizing on the firing of several Iraqi weapons to
launch a withering assault. The ferocity of the American attack is not in
question. American ground and air units all but pulverized a Republican Guard
tank division on March 2, 1991, in one of the most devastating and one-sided
battles of the war.

A number of General McCaffrey's fellow commanders, including Lt. Col. Patrick
Lamar, who was the division's operations officer, told Mr. Hersh that
excessive firepower was used against a weakened and retreating Iraqi force
that did not seriously threaten the Americans. They believe that the American
assault was a clear and willful violation of the cease-fire rules of
engagement that had been established by the Pentagon. General McCaffrey
maintains that he acted properly to defend his troops after the Iraqi forces
initiated combat. He denies that he blocked their escape route in hopes of
forcing a confrontation.

Mr. Hersh examines other serious charges involving General McCaffrey's
troops, including reports that they massacred a group of Iraqi prisoners of
war, but the evidence he cites here is not definitive. The Army's
investigations of all these matters, which cleared General McCaffrey and the
division, should not be the last word. The military services have a poor
record of holding their own members accountable for misconduct, especially
top officers.

As Walter Cronkite, the former CBS News anchorman, noted in a letter to The
Times earlier this week, the Pentagon's efforts to restrict coverage of the
war denied the American people an immediate and full account of the battles
American forces fought in Kuwait and Iraq. More comprehensive coverage might
long ago have clarified whether General McCaffrey's order to attack was
appropriate.

The Senate did not inquire deeply into the 24th Infantry Division's actions
when it approved promotions for General McCaffrey after the war or when it
confirmed his appointment to the drug policy post. Secretary of Defense
William Cohen should appoint an independent review panel. If he does not, the
Senate or House should conduct its own investigation. If General McCaffrey
acted responsibly, he should welcome an unflinching examination of the facts.

U.S. Conducts Mock Biological, Chemical Attacks
By Patrick Connole

WASHINGTON (Reuters) - A series of mock terrorist attacks began on Saturday
in the United States, testing the ability of top local, state and federal
officials to respond to a catastrophic sequence of biological and chemical
releases.

In Portsmouth, New Hampshire, a spoof explosion of a Chevrolet van loaded
with unknown chemical agents kicked off the drill a few hours after daybreak
near the town's port, fictionally killing and maiming around 50 people.

A biological ``attack'' took place outside Denver, Colorado, and a third
series of exercises were being run in and around the nation's capital, the
Justice Department said.


Called ``Topoff'' -- short for Top Officials -- the largest ever such dress
rehearsal is being conducted by the Department of Justice and the Federal
Emergency Management Agency.

Thousands will participate in the 10-day exercise, including Attorney General
Janet Reno, other Cabinet members, mayors, local and state police, hospital
personnel and volunteer actors playing the role of injured and dead
civilians, according to the Justice Department.

``The goal of the exercise is to assess the nation's crisis and consequence
management capacity under extraordinarily stressful conditions,'' said Gina
Talamona, a Justice Department spokeswoman.

At a cost of $3.5 million, Topoff is the largest drill of its kind ever
conducted in the United States, and while the various officials knew the
exercise was to take place, they did not know before the exercise the size
and scope of what they were going to have to deal with, and still may not.

``No one was surprised, that's not the critical part. People knew this was a
drill they were responding to, but not to what they were responding to,''
said Jim Van Dongen from the New Hampshire Office of Emergency Management.

No Plans For Public Panic

``Topoff'' is being carefully orchestrated so as not to alarm the general
public. Police in responding areas are not using sirens and though physical
activity is taking place on the ground, it is not being done in a way to
excite the uninformed.

``The intent is to make sure this does not turn into the War of the Worlds,''
said a source with the Clinton administration, referring to the radio play
produced by Orson Welles in the 1930s which scared many Americans into
thinking Martians were attacking the planet.

In the Portsmouth attack, local officials said shortly after 8:20 a.m. EDT,
at the start of a make believe charity foot race, a fake car bombing sent a
foul smelling concoction of garlic mixed with Gatorade over the picturesque
Portsmouth Port Authority facility.

``A Portsmouth police officer was the first on the scene, then fire trucks,''
said Van Dongen.

Following procedure, local authorities called in toxic hazard teams, then
informed the statehouse of what was happening. Federal involvement followed,
after the governor's office requested a presidential disaster declaration,
freeing the FBI and FEMA to respond to the incident.

FBI Special Agent Barry Mawn told reporters the exercise was ``going pretty
well,'' as federal agents and police scurried around the dead and wounded in
Portsmouth.

The spoof terror incident in Colorado actually began two days ago under a
scenario in which a ``terrorist'' released ''anthrax spores'' in Denver.

Police were called to a Denver hotel room after a body was found. But what
first looked like a simple death soon turned into something else when police
noticed vomit and blood.

Other ``information'' that the Federal Bureau of Investigation had
``received'' about the same time prompted sending hazardous material
personnel to the scene.

Soon the bomb squad was dispatched to the hotel room, which was actually on
an old army hospital. Other events were expected during the 10-day exercise
in the Denver metropolitan area.

Congress Mandated Terror Drills

``Topoff'' stems from a provision inserted in a 1998 spending bill by
Republican Sen. Judd Gregg of New Hampshire calling for ``practice
operations'' for a terror attack.

Critics of the exercise say it overstates the real threats facing America and
that such a broad range of attacks would be unlikely to happen all at the
same time.

In congressional testimony in March, CIA Director George Tenet said major
threats to U.S. security came from groups such as Saudi exile Osama bin
Laden's, which were trying to acquire biological and chemical weapons
capabilities.

Tenet said over the next few years U.S. cities faced ballistic missile
threats from a wide variety of sources: North Korea, probably Iran and
possibly Iraq.

WHO OWNS HUMAN GENOME? GENESIS?

A new gold rush is on. But this time financiers are pouring fabulous
sums into prospecting for something far more valuable than gold. It is
the hunt for the genes that make humans function.

Although scientists predict the discoveries will fuel rapid advances
in medical care, many are concerned that the predicted miracle
therapies may be delayed and prove too pricey for many patients to
afford.

Their fears focus on the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office, which has
amassed a backlog of more than 10,000 applications for patents on
genetic discoveries, with more flooding in every day.

Many leading genetic scientists fear that if the office approves most
of these applications, the resulting swamp of overlapping patents
could bog down genetic testing and stagnate the development of new
drugs.

In part, the concern stems from powerful new technologies that are
making many of the discoveries possible. Until recently,
identification and location of a human gene was a laborious search
that started with a protein and worked backward to the gene that
produces it. Usually, scientists understood an important function of
the gene before they found it.

But today, the sequence has been reversed. Robotic laboratories are
shredding and sequencing DNA on an industrial scale and spitting out
the code for almost countless pieces of genes.

With powerful computers combing through public databases, scientists
can find similar snippets of genome to which scientists have traced a
function. These so-called homology searches may be enough to satisfy
the patent examiners that a newly "discovered" piece-of-a-gene is
useful enough to get a patent, according to John Doll, who heads the
office's biotechnology section.

That could produce "a cross-licensing nightmare," complains Michael
Watson, former co-chairman of the genetic testing group advising the
National Institutes of Health and Department of Energy, in which many
parties wind up with rights to parts of the same gene.

Dr. Francis Collins, director of the National Institutes of Health's
National Human Genome Research Institute, shares that fear. When
researchers want to study a broad cross-section of genes, Collins
theorizes, "they're going to have a very hard time doing it without
infringing on several people's patents."

"You'll have the whole genome sort of Balkanized with all these pieces
that have fences around them," Collins says. The result, he fears, is
that much important research will not be performed.

What's more, Collins argues that proposed new gene patenting rules
will allow people to get a patent based on educated guesses that a
section of DNA does what similar pieces do — guesses that in many
cases will prove wrong or insignificant compared to the gene's other
functions. And others worry that patents will drive up the cost of
genetic testing while chilling the improvement of test methods — or
that they already have.

Myriad Genetics Inc. of Salt Lake City, for instance, warned the
University of Pennsylvania's genetics laboratory to stop conducting
broad tests for two genes that have been linked to elevated breast
cancer risk. Penn said it was performing the tests for half the price
that Myriad Genetics charges for its test for the genes.

Dr. Debra G. B. Leonard, director of Penn's Molecular Pathology
Laboratory and president of the Association for Molecular Biology,
compares Myriad's move to a company monopolizing appendectomies and
charging $10,000 for them. Some people won't be able to afford the
procedure, she says, and the monopoly prevents others from improving
the test.

Myriad argues that it was the first to find the breast cancer genes
and patent the test for them. "We don't want people to use that to go
into business and compete with us," says the firm's spokesman, Bill
Hockett.

Hockett contends Myriad's test is more accurate than Penn's, that it
can be obtained by doctors across the United States, and that the
company has a program to lower the cost to patients who cannot afford
the full price.

But Leonard's view is widely shared in the medical community. "We feel
strongly that the whole fruits of the genome project will be
unavailable" if most of the backlogged applications lead to patents,
says (Dr.) Rod Howell, president of the American College of Medical
Genetics. "It's absolutely essential that we have testing that is
accessible and affordable."

An ethical swamp, too
Some people voice moral objections to patenting human genes. Dr.
Robert Nussbaum, a molecular geneticist at NIH, calls patenting human
DNA "abhorrent." And doing it by searching public databases for
similar pieces of DNA is "intellectually dishonest," Nussbaum says.
